Tony winner Alan Cumming looks back on life in 'Cabaret'

we revisit interviews with two dynamic Tony-winning stars from Broadway’s past, starting with ALAN CUMMING who has been acting in television, movies, and theater since the 1980s. He won a Tony for his role as the Emcee in the revival of “Cabaret” 1998, a role he also played in the 1993 London production and again in a 2014 revival. He won a second Tony in 2022 as a producer of the musical “A Strange Loop”. Most recently, he has been the host of the Emmy-winning Peacock reality competition series “The Traitors.”

'Hamilton' producer Jeffrey Seller traces his journey from 'Theater Kid' to Broadway

Producer JEFFREY SELLER. He produced Rent with his business partner. Seller's own company produced Hamilton. He also was a producer of Lin Manuel Miranda’s first musical, In the Heights – as well as the satirical adult puppet musical, Avenue Q, and the revival of Sondheim’s Sweeney Todd, starring Josh Groban. Seller grew up without much money in a neighborhood outside Detroit that was nicknamed Cardboard Village, because the houses were so cheap and shoddy. Seller is the author of the memoir Theater Kid.

'Schmigadoon!' co-creator says series was inspired by a 'love affair' with musicals

Cinco Paul loves musicals — unlike his long-time writing partner. Their Apple TV+ series, now on Broadway, centers on a couple who become trapped in a musical town. Originally broadcast Aug. 23, 2021.
